The birth of AI has had a profound impact on the design industry, changing the processes, tools and industry landscape. Here are the main impacts and possible future trends of AI on the design industry:

1. Increased design efficiency

Automated design tools: AI can handle repetitive tasks such as automatic generation of sketches, pattern fills, colour adjustments, etc., allowing designers to focus on the more creative parts of the process. For example, Adobe's AI tool Sensei helps designers automate specific editing tasks in image and video processing.

Accelerating the design process: AI-assisted design software can quickly generate multiple solutions, allowing designers to try out different styles and colour combinations in a short period of time, thus improving efficiency and shortening the design cycle.

2. Personalised design and user experience optimisation

Customized design solutions: AI can provide personalized design solutions based on user preferences and behavioural data. For example, by analysing user data, AI can generate personalised advertisements, websites or application interfaces to enhance user experience.

Predicting user needs: AI can analyse users' behavioural habits through machine learning, thus predicting their potential needs and helping designers to more accurately meet the expectations of target users in their designs.

3. Creativity and inspiration stimulation

Intelligent Generation of Design Inspiration: AI generation tools can provide designers with a large number of design references and inspirations, and stimulate designers' creativity by generating diverse sketches or styles. For example, AI can generate different art styles or recommend colour combinations to help designers find new creative directions.

Enhanced human-machine cooperation: AI, as a creative assistant, can interact and collaborate with designers and even help them overcome design bottlenecks. The mode of human-machine cooperation allows designers to quickly try out new concepts and design elements with the assistance of AI.

4. Lowering the design threshold

Popularise the design capabilities of non-professionals: the intelligence and user-friendliness of AI design tools make it easy for non-professionals to create design works. This means that more people can participate in design without having to have deep professional skills.

Popularity of templated designs: Many AI design tools offer templates and automated design options that allow simple design tasks to be automated, which allows small businesses and individuals to complete design work at a much lower cost.

5. Redefinition of industry competition

Shifting Role of the Designer: As AI takes on more and more repetitive tasks in design, the role of the designer is shifting from ‘creator’ to ‘guide’ or ‘planner’, focusing on a more strategic approach. to ‘guide’ or ‘planner,’ focusing on more strategic and creative work.

Increased Competition and Value Shift: The proliferation of AI design tools may lead to increased competition in the design market, with basic design tasks being replaced by automation. In the future, designers will need to be more creative and strategic to remain competitive in the industry.

6. AI design ethics and copyright issues

Copyright attribution: AI-generated design works bring up the issue of copyright attribution, especially when AI is more deeply involved in the creation, how to define copyright attribution is a new legal issue.

Homogenisation of design styles: AI relies on a large amount of existing data for learning and therefore may lead to homogenisation of design styles, making the design industry lose its diversity and uniqueness, especially when a large number of designs are generated from similar algorithms.

7 Future trends and possibilities

The need for AI-assisted skills for designers: as AI becomes more prevalent in the design industry, designers in the future may need to acquire AI-related technologies and data analysis skills to better utilise AI tools to get the job done.

Convergence of design and data science: in the future, designers may need to rely more on data analysis to understand user needs through AI and big data, and provide users with more personalised design solutions.
